I have an 02 F4i with a bent rim and fork after my wreck

You can use just about any front end fork, but you have to replace just about everything else with it - triples, wheel, brakes, etc.
Upgrading to a different model forks can also alter the bike's performance, possibly in a way that you don't like. Personally, I'd recommend sticking with F4i forks, and swapping the internals if you want better performance. It'll cost about the same and the bike will handle normally.
